OnePlus 7T Pro 5G McLaren has a general score of 80.1, which is just a bit better than Xiaomi 12's overall score of 78.8. The OnePlus 7T Pro 5G McLaren is an a lot older, somewhat heavier and a bit thicker cellphone than Xiaomi 12. Both phones we are comparing here use Android OS, but OnePlus 7T Pro 5G McLaren has an older 10 version and Xiaomi 12 has Android 12 version.
OnePlus 7T Pro 5G McLaren has a very superior processing unit than Xiaomi 12, and although they both have 8 cores, the OnePlus 7T Pro 5G McLaren also has 4 GB more RAM. The Xiaomi 12 features a little sharper display than OnePlus 7T Pro 5G McLaren, although it has a way lower 1080 x 2400 pixels resolution, a quite lower pixels count in each inch of display and a bit smaller screen.
The Xiaomi 12 counts with a slightly better camera than OnePlus 7T Pro 5G McLaren, because although it has a tinier aperture, it also counts with a much higher 7680x4320 video definition, a better 50 mega pixels resolution camera and a much larger sensor capturing lot better quality pictures. The OnePlus 7T Pro 5G McLaren features a much better storage capacity for apps and games than Xiaomi 12, because it has 256 GB internal memory.
Xiaomi 12 features just a bit better battery performance than OnePlus 7T Pro 5G McLaren, because it has a 10 percent larger battery size.
